I'm not sure what this feature is called in Firefox lingo...

On my Mac, Firefox will remember which windows belong on which virtual desktops, and so open up with them on the correct (well, not exactly, but sorta) virtual desktops after a restart of the app.

On my new Windows 10 installation, though, Firefox has learned that a specific window was moved to virtual desktop 2, and now INSISTS that that window should always open on the desktop after a restart, regardless of on which desktop that window was actually placed when Firefox was shut down.

Is there a quick fix for this issue, or at least some way to disable this feature?
